When I'm taking photos for the website I create little vignettes & have lots of different photos to choose from. But I can only pick one photo for the product on the website so often others get deleted or if I particularly like them I keep them & they end up getting stored on Flickr!
I have been taking some new product photos these last few days & have uploaded them to Flickr & whilst I was there I was browsing different photos & I found this photo which I had taken a while ago.
It was one of the product shots I took of the pretty vintage style photo frame (which you can find *here*) & I really like it ~ wonder why I didn't use it!!!
*smiles quizically*
Anyhoo, the photo frame is obviously from the Vintage Amethyst Boutique, the little pot of roses tends to crop up from time to time in photos as I love it so!
I bought the roses about 7 years ago now, they are foam faux roses but are so so pretty.
They have bendy stems, so I bend the stems & placed them in this small plain white pot from Ikea.
I think they look pretty in this pot as you can't see the stems & it tends to be the stems of faux flowers that look bad I always think.  
The metal pitcher is one I bought a few years ago in a sale. I can't remember how much it was but it was only cheap I remember. I was a pale blue but everywhere I put it it just didn't fit in very well. It was a lovely pale blue but everywhere it was placed it just seemed like the wrong blue so I decided to give it a little makeover & got some cream spray paint & painted it!
The cute little cabinet that they are sitting on was a wonderful thrifty find a few years ago, but I've painted it since. It does tend to crop up in photos & I have promised before to do a blog post dedicated to it as it really is a sweetie but alas I haven't as of yet!!!

*Cath Kidston Giveaway*

Have you seen the latest Cath Kidston giveaway?
Well it is perfect for those of you passionate about sewing!!!

Calling all sewing enthusiasts!
Cath Kidston have linked up with the Bedruthan Steps Hotel in Cornwall to run a series of sewing weekends to celebrate our love of all things creative. Expert staff will host a step by step course showing you how to make 2 exciting projects from Cath's latest book Patch! The Weekend includes two nights accommodation, meals, homemade refreshments and everything you need to make the 2 projects from the book, all worth £340.
There are 2 breaks run by Lisa Comfort from London Sewing Café 'Sew Over It' taking place from March 9th - 11th and May 11th - 13th 2012.

*International Orders*

I've made a decision & a difficult one at that, which I have mulled over for many weeks now, which unfortunately affects international customers.
I'm afraid I've decided to stop posting internationally at the moment due to the fact that over the last 6 months so many orders posted to different countries are being damaged or being lost!
It seems as if lately it is every other parcel that is damaged or lost & this costs me time & money, not to say stress as I want all my customers to be happy customers & when things arrived damaged or not at all (!) I feel as if I personally have let them down.
I must say though that all Vintage Amethyst customers are so lovely & understanding & I'm glad to say not one has been nasty at all, which I really appreciate as I know how frustrating it can be when things don't arrive as you imagined.
So I'm sorry to say that as of last night I have ceased taking international orders on the website.
All the international order that were placed over the last few days have been posted yesterday so they will (hopefully!) be with you very soon.
